Adversa AI researchers disclosed a technique called Cryptographic Context Injection that bypasses AI safety filters by encrypting malicious instructions in AES-256-GCM, which the targeted models decrypt and execute without triggering guardrails. Demonstrated attacks against xAI's Grok and Google's Gemini included a zero-click exploit exfiltrating Grok users' full chat histories and prompting Gemini to generate dangerous instructions and reproduce its own system prompts. The vulnerability exposes a fundamental structural weakness in content-based guardrails, which cannot inspect payloads that only become readable after the model has already decided to trust them, with limited vendor engagement and no coordinated disclosure path at Google due to their AI reward program exclusions.
Microsoft disclosed a maximum-severity remote code execution vulnerability in Entra ID (CVE-2026-69836, CVSS 10.0) caused by unsafe deserialization, then reversed its advisory's "Exploited: Yes" designation to "No" without explanation a day later, leaving enterprises uncertain whether active attacks occurred. The company server-side patched the flaw affecting its cloud identity platform that underpins Microsoft 365, Azure, and thousands of federated applications, but declined to disclose detection methods, scope of exposure, or evidence supporting either exploitation claim. The reversal raises questions about transparency in vulnerability reporting, particularly for cloud services where only the provider holds forensic facts needed to assess materiality under emerging SEC and CISA disclosure frameworks.
